admin

互动插件开发指南:提升用户体验的关键一步

admin 百家乐资讯 2025-07-14 146浏览 0

在当今快速发展的数字世界中,用户对产品的期望不断提高,特别是在交互体验方面。互动插件作为提升用户体验和增加功能的一种重要手段,已经成为现代软件开发中不可或缺的一部分。通过灵活的插件,开发者能够快速实现各种互动功能,不仅增强了用户参与感,也为产品的多样性和灵活性加分。如何开发一款高效的互动插件呢?本文将为你详细解析互动插件的开发过程。

互动插件开发指南:提升用户体验的关键一步
(图片来源网络,侵删)

什么是互动插件?

互动插件,顾名思义,是指一种能够与用户进行实时交互的功能模块。它通常嵌入在应用程序或网页中,提供即时的反馈、互动或者信息更新。常见的互动插件包括在线聊天、评论系统、投票功能、互动表单等。这些插件不仅能够增强用户的参与感,还能为网站或应用提供更多的互动性和个性化服务。

为什么要开发互动插件?

互动插件的开发具有多方面的好处。它可以提升用户的参与度。现代用户对静态内容的接受度逐渐降低,互动性强的内容能够更加吸引他们的注意力。互动插件能够增强用户对产品或品牌的忠诚度。例如,在线客服插件可以解决用户的疑问,提升用户体验,从而增强客户的信任感和满意度。

互动插件还有助于收集用户数据。通过互动过程,开发者可以了解用户的需求和偏好,从而进行产品优化。这不仅有助于提升用户体验,还能为未来的开发提供宝贵的参考数据。

互动插件的核心要素

开发一款优秀的互动插件,首先要明确几个核心要素:用户体验、响应速度、兼容性和易用性。

用户体验:互动插件的首要任务是让用户感到舒适和便捷。因此,插件的界面设计需要简洁直观,操作流程要清晰易懂。一个复杂或繁琐的插件往往会让用户产生反感,降低互动的频率和效果。

响应速度:响应速度是用户体验的另一大关键因素。无论是在线客服、表单提交还是实时数据更新,用户都期望能够得到及时的反馈。如果插件响应缓慢,用户的体验将大打折扣,甚至可能导致用户流失。

兼容性:互动插件需要在不同的操作系统、浏览器以及设备上都能良好运行。因此,开发者需要确保插件能够适配多种环境,保证其稳定性和兼容性。

易用性:即使是最先进的互动功能,也必须考虑到用户的操作习惯。插件的设计应该遵循简洁、直观的原则,让用户在使用时不会感到困惑或迷茫。越是简单易用的插件,越能让用户产生良好的使用体验。

开发互动插件的步骤

开发互动插件的过程可以分为几个关键步骤。明确需求。开发者需要了解用户的具体需求,以及插件的功能要求。比如,是需要实现一个实时聊天系统,还是一个调查问卷系统?不同的需求决定了插件的设计和功能。

设计用户界面。用户界面的设计是互动插件开发中的一个重要环节。简洁、美观且符合用户操作习惯的界面将大大提升插件的使用体验。在设计时,开发者应考虑到用户的使用场景,避免过多的干扰和复杂的操作流程。

接下来是技术实现。根据设计好的界面和功能需求,开发者可以选择合适的技术栈进行实现。常见的互动插件技术包括JavaScript、HTML5、CSS3等前端技术,服务器端则可以选择Node.js、PHP、Python等后端技术。开发者需要根据具体需求选择适合的技术工具。

进行测试和优化。测试是确保插件功能正常、性能稳定的关键环节。在测试过程中,开发者应检查插件的兼容性、响应速度以及用户体验,及时修复问题和优化性能。

常见的互动插件类型

实时聊天插件:这种插件可以帮助网站或应用实现即时的用户支持。通过实时聊天功能,用户可以直接与客服人员进行互动,解决问题。实时聊天插件能够极大地提高用户的满意度,尤其在电商网站和客户服务平台中应用广泛。

评论和评分插件:评论和评分功能能够让用户对产品或服务进行评价,并与其他用户分享经验。这个插件有助于提高用户的参与度和忠诚度,同时也能为新用户提供参考意见。

投票和调查插件:通过投票或调查插件,开发者可以收集用户的意见和反馈。这类插件通常用于了解用户的需求、调查市场趋势或参与产品优化。

互动表单插件:互动表单插件是用户与网站或应用互动的另一个重要方式。它通常用于用户注册、订阅、问卷调查等场景。通过简洁明了的表单设计,开发者可以让用户更方便地提供信息。

总结

互动插件的开发不仅能够提高用户的参与度,还能增强产品的灵活性和功能性。通过设计简洁、美观、易用的互动插件,开发者可以提升产品的用户体验,增加用户的粘性。在接下来的部分中,我们将继续深入探讨如何优化互动插件的开发流程,提高其性能和功能。

优化互动插件的开发流程

在开发互动插件的过程中,如何优化插件的性能和功能,确保其能够顺利运行并为用户提供高效的互动体验,是开发者需要重点关注的方向。我们将详细介绍一些优化互动插件的有效方法。

1.减少加载时间

插件的加载速度直接影响到用户的体验。尤其是在移动设备上,用户对加载时间的敏感度更高。如果一个插件需要很长时间才能加载完毕,用户可能会产生等待疲劳,甚至选择离开。因此,开发者在设计互动插件时,应尽量减少插件的加载时间。

可以通过以下方式优化加载速度:

压缩资源:通过压缩图片、JavaScript和CSS文件,减少资源的大小,提升加载速度。

异步加载:在插件的开发过程中,尽量采用异步加载的方式,避免阻塞页面的渲染。这样可以确保用户能够在插件加载过程中继续浏览页面。

懒加载:懒加载是一种按需加载的技术,它能够减少初始加载的资源量,只在用户需要时加载相应的内容。通过懒加载,插件的初始加载时间将大大减少,提升用户的体验。

2.提升插件的可扩展性

随着产品的不断发展,用户的需求和插件的功能也会不断变化。为了满足这些变化,插件的可扩展性就显得尤为重要。开发者应确保插件在未来能够方便地进行功能扩展和优化。

实现插件的可扩展性可以通过以下几个方式:

模块化设计:将插件的功能进行模块化设计,使得每个功能模块可以独立开发和更新。这样可以提高插件的可维护性,也便于未来的功能扩展。

插件化架构:采用插件化架构可以让开发者在不影响主应用的情况下,灵活地扩展插件的功能。插件化架构还可以方便地进行版本管理和功能更新。

3.保持兼容性和稳定性

兼容性和稳定性是互动插件能否成功推广的关键。一个不兼容主流浏览器和操作系统的插件,很难在用户中普及。因此,在开发过程中,开发者必须确保插件能够适配不同的浏览器和操作系统,尤其是在移动端和PC端之间的兼容性。

插件的稳定性也至关重要。插件应尽量减少出错的概率,避免由于系统崩溃或错误操作导致的用户体验不佳。开发者应进行充分的测试,确保插件在各种情况下都能稳定运行。

4.收集用户反馈

开发互动插件后,及时收集用户反馈是非常重要的。通过用户的反馈,开发者可以发现插件在实际使用中的问题,并进行针对性的优化。例如,用户可能反映某些功能不够直观,或者某些交互存在不流畅的地方。通过分析这些反馈,开发者能够不断改进插件,提高其性能和用户体验。

5.定期更新与维护

随着技术的不断发展和用户需求的变化,互动插件需要不断更新和维护。定期发布新版本和修复已知的bug,不仅能够保持插件的稳定性,还能增强用户对插件的信任度和依赖感。开发者应定期检查插件的运行状况,并根据用户需求和技术趋势进行优化。

总结

开发互动插件不仅仅是实现一个简单的功能模块,它关乎着整个用户体验的提升。通过优化插件的加载速度、增强插件的可扩展性、保持兼容性和稳定性,以及及时收集用户反馈,开发者可以创造出更具吸引力和实用性的互动插件。随着产品和用户需求的不断变化,互动插件也应不断更新和优化,才能在激烈的市场竞争中脱颖而出,成为提升用户体验和产品价值的重要工具。

继续浏览有关 插件用户互动开发者体验 的文章